Analysis of Single Reservoir Dispatching During a Sudden Accident of Water Pollution in a Long Distance River Channel
This paper establishes the hydrodynamic model and mathematical pollutant transport and diffusion model of long distance river channel and cascade reservoir and verifies the models by analytic solutions of pollutant transport and diffusion, and sets up eleven dispatching modes of single reservoir and...
